'The Simpsons' Springfield is in Oregon

Matt Groening, creator of "The Simpsons,'' guest appearance in "The Simpsons" (April 14, 2004) Credit: FOX
"The Simpsons" has long been based in a fictional city known by the name of Springfield — to which you say, "d'oh dude — that's only the best-known piece of pop culture trivia in the entire known universe." True (dude) but not known is where is Springfield? There are thousands of Springfields out there, each claiming to be the real Springfield, with Matt Groening politely declining to give any of them the satisfaction of claiming the prize. Until now... He says in a recent interview that the inspiration came from hometown Springfield, Oregeon (on the outskirts of Eugene); ipso facto, Springfield of "The Simpsons" is in Oregon. Sort of.
